I-20 West traffic update: St. Clair County/Riverside Bridge repair finished, reopens early
Reading time: 1 minute

Traffic on I-20 west bound entering St.Clair County toward Birmingham is now open.
After a five-day maintenance project, the bridge over the Coosa River in Riverside is back open.
Fixing 62 year-old I-20 bridge
As reported by Bham Now last month, starting last Thursday, October 2, Alabama Department of Transportation crews alternated lane closures on the span to replace finger joints and the surrounding concrete on the 62-year-old bridge.
The work caused heavy delays on I-20, the primary road connecting Atlanta to Birmingham.
In addition to the opening, the repairs on the bridge was finished two days ahead of schedule according to ALDOT.
